MAJOR PAUL PELLETIER- The Salvation Army
 
 
MAJOR PAUL PELLETIER Officer in Charge for the Norristown area Salvation nArmy, spoke to us last week, giving an overview of the history, goals, and services of the Salvation Army.  The  Army was founded in 1865 in England, and is now a world wide church and charitable organization. They aim  to assist those in need both spiritually and physically assisting them with a wide variety of services like thrift stores, homeless shelters, food distributions to name a few.  The Army is also very active in disaster relief, with local officers and workers jumping in immediately followed closely by assistance from outside the immediate territory.

Major Pelletier has been in Norristown for 7 months after serving in Massachusetts and several other  spots around the world. He stated that one of the main projects recently implemented is the family shelter, which serves as temporary home for families as  the Army attempts to find more permanent housing for them.  They also  have a winter shelter for women in colder temperatures. He noted our Club's gift of sheets to the shelter, and also thanked us for  the bell ringing day we participates in. It was their largest single day collection this year.
